OverflowBar runs locally on your Mac and does not include analytics, advertising, telemetry, or network data collection.
- Accessibility is used to discover menu bar controls, invoke supported press actions, and perform user-requested menu bar arrangement changes.
- Screen Recording is used to capture the small visual regions belonging to selected menu bar items so they can be represented in the overflow row.
Captured menu bar images are held in memory for the current app session. OverflowBar does not upload them or write them to a remote service.
OverflowBar stores selected item identifiers, layout preferences, onboarding completion, hover behavior, and login-item state locally using macOS system preferences. Removing the app does not automatically remove those preferences.
